Would someone educate me. by Purple-Virus5921 in fountainpens

[–]Jumpy-Translator-805 2 points3 points  (0 children)

Good questions!

  1. A flex nib is a nib that produces a line whose thickness varies with (reasonable) pressure. More pressure, thicker line. The benifits depend on the person & their style of writing. Some folks like a stiffer nib, and others really enjoy a softer nib that they can push to get some line variation. Flex nibs are certainly currently in vogue, but it's definitely a matter of personal preference.

  2. I'm not sure what exact writing style you mean when you say 'calligraphy look' -- but if you're thinking of a style with varied line thickness, a (properly used) flex nib could help. With handwriting, though, I find that it's 95% in the person, and 5% the pen.

  3. Most (but not all) nibs are fairly easily removable & replaceable, but not all nibs are cross-compatible. This is partly because many different nib sizes exist. Nib sizes are generally loosely determined by the width of the nib/feed (in mm) where it meets the section. But that's a whole other non-standardized can of worms!
